Botanical Features Of The Algerian Sahara (1913) is a comprehensive book written by William Austin Cannon. The book is an in-depth study of the plant life found in the Algerian Sahara region. It provides a detailed description of the various species of plants, their morphology, and their distribution in the region. The book also includes illustrations and photographs of the plants, making it easier for the readers to identify them. The author has used a scientific approach to study the plants, and the book is an excellent resource for botanists, researchers, and students interested in the flora of the Algerian Sahara. The book also provides information on the climate, soil, and topography of the region, which has a significant impact on the growth and distribution of the plants.
